## Environments — Thistledown Autoscaler

Three environments: dev, staging, prod. The autoscaler polls queue depth on the Harrowmere broker and scales worker pools accordingly. Dev uses a shared broker; staging and prod are isolated. Scaling credentials are scoped per environment; no cross-environment reads. Security review scope: prod only. Scale-up is capped; scale-down respects drain timeouts. Prod runs with the following configuration values.

service settings:
[casax]
port = 6379
team = rusir
host = casax.zemvarhq.corp
region = outer-4
access_code = ac_9808ce
timeout_ms = 1500

Transaction throughput improved measurably, and staff training costs came in under the modeled estimate. Hardware depreciation assumptions held, though maintenance visits ran slightly above plan. Quindle's procurement group has signaled interest in a chain-wide deployment, contingent on pricing. Finance should model the scenarios circulated last week. The proposed commercial structure is summarized in the confidential note that follows.

internal memo for yahag-hahig: Belwynix Group plans to lower the Silir list price by 62 percent in May.

// Broker upgrade notes for plugin authors:
// Quillbus 4.x replaces the legacy 3.x wire protocol. Plugins must
// construct the client with explicit protocol negotiation enabled,
// or connections to the Larkfield cluster will be silently downgraded
// and dropped after 30s. Topic names are unchanged. For local testing
// against the sandbox broker, authenticate with the key below.

API key for bafof-bagaf: qvz2-qi

**Ticket #: Timing-chip reader sign-off needed**

The Fleetmark chip readers at the finish mat occasionally double-count runners crossing in tight packs. Fix dedupes reads within a 400ms window per chip. Works in testing, but race day is unforgiving, so don't ship without review. Future maintainers: the dedupe window is configurable. Sign-off required from the person below.

named custodian: Brivan Eliath Quenox Frador